    Hello,
    Please check the following:
    1. Application server name, the SAP GUI and the portal should be logged into the same application server.
    2. You should be logged in with the same User in both SAP GUI and the Portal.
    3. External debugging should be enabled for the User in SAP GUI.
    4. Also try checking the check box , IP Matching . This can be done as below:
    Utilities -> Settings ->  ABAP Editor -> Debugging ->  IP Matching.
    Also please check the following in the above link , if you have the same user name here with which you have logged onto Portal and the New Debugger Radio Button is Selected.

  • How to boot your phone into safe mode

    If you experience any problem with your phone, booting it into safe mode can be a good idea to check if any third party applications might be involved in the problem you’re having.
    If you run your phone in safe mode for a while and you don’t experience any problem, the problem you’re having is most likely related to a third party app that you’ve installed.
    How to boot into safe mode differ from models to model and it can also be different depending on firmware version but this topic will explain to you how to do it.
    NOTE!
    Booting into safe mode may change personal UI customizations such as icons and folders.
    Later Xperia phones running on Android Jelly Bean (Android 4.1 or later)
    Press and hold the on/off key until you get this screen.
    Now tap and hold the Power off option until you see this screen.
    Press OK to reboot into safe mode.
    If you have successfully booted into safe mode you will see the text Safe mode in the bottom left corner.
    You can also boot into safe mode by turning off the phone and wait a few seconds. Now press and hold both the on/off and volume down (-) key. Keep pressing these two keys until the phone has booted completely.
    To exit safe mode you simply power off and power on as normal.
    Xperia phones using touch menu key running on Android GB (2.3.X) or ICS (4.0.X)
    Turn off your phone.  Wait a few seconds and then turn it on again. Now during the boot process start tapping the menu key continuously and keep tapping until the phone has booted completely. Not too fast, not too slow. The beat of Iron man by Black Sabbath is just right.
    To exit safe mode you simply power off and power on as normal.
    Xperia phones using hardware menu key
    Turn off your phone.  Wait a few seconds and then turn in on again. Now during the boot process press and hold the menu key until the phone has booted completely.
    To exit safe mode you simply power off and power on as normal.

  • JTREE request edit mode for one node

    hello,
    my jtree is editable
    tree.setEditable(true); // double click on a node and it goes in "edit mode"
    I would like to set a specific node into "edit mode" (just like when you create a new folder in windows - new folder appears in edit mode - you just have to type the name of the folder)
    //set the node selected
    setSelectionPath(new TreePath(newfolder.getPath()));
    // set the node in edit mode - does not exist ???
    setEdit((new TreePath(newfolder.getPath())); ????
    Second question:
    how can I avoid a specific node from being editable ?
    // set all the nodes editable !!
    tree.setEditable(true);
    thanks a lot !

    polo777 wrote:
    I would like to set a specific node into "edit mode" (just like when you create a new folder in windows - new folder appears in edit mode - you just have to type the name of the folder)[JTree.startEditingAtPath|http://java.sun.com/j2se/1.5.0/docs/api/javax/swing/JTree.html#startEditingAtPath(javax.swing.tree.TreePath)].
    how can I avoid a specific node from being editable ?Override [JTree.isPathEditable|http://java.sun.com/j2se/1.5.0/docs/api/javax/swing/JTree.html#isPathEditable(javax.swing.tree.TreePath)].
